CLEVELAND, Ohio (WOIO) – A girl is now dealing with felony housebreaking costs for allegedly making herself at house inside a stranger’s home in Trumbull County.

Police had been referred to as on Wednesday after a Brookfield Township resident returned house and located an unknown girl, later recognized by investigators as Cassandra Pacheco, inside.

Brookfield Township police stated the 59-year-old admitted to coming into the house after she discovered an unlocked door.

Pacheco then drank a part of a White Claw beverage earlier than placing it again into the fridge, cooked a Scorching Pocket and lasagna, and took a bubble tub within the stranger’s house, in accordance with police.

“Reminder to lock not solely your automotive doorways, but in addition your home doorways. You by no means know who you may discover making dinner or taking a shower while you get house,” Brookfield Township police shared on Fb.

It’s not recognized presently why Pacheco picked the actual Brookfield Township neighborhood.

Pacheco was on the porch of the home when police arrived. She was booked on the Trumbull County Jail for housebreaking.
